Solomon Hornsby, Male Human [Permalink]

Personal [hide]

Description: This man is bedraggled and starved. He wears very tight pants and wife beaters, though occasionally he sports a blue coat. He has a long blonde beard with little hanging trinkets. His otherwise smooth face is marked with small tiny scars.

Personality: He considers himself the protector of his home. He feels this is his duty and calling. More though he will beg to come along on any journeys. He will attempt to stowaway on any ship he can in the hopes that it will get him further away.

History: His history is one of pain. He was disowned by both parents and raised among the slaves his parents kept. His family was turned out during the war. He and his family wandered west to less war torn lands. He was forced to fight in gladiatorial arenas alongside his partner. They became the best of friends and one day they managed to break out together and then went their separate ways.

Motivation: He is currently in port desperately looking for someone to get him out; and to clean up the streets

Ideals: Fighting. Flaws: PTSD. Bonds: Poor, Guardian, Slave. Occupation: Scribe

Voice: German accent

Jocelyn Preston, Male Human [Permalink]

Personal [hide]

Description: He is an attractive man, lean and moderately muscular. He wears a large hat to cast shadows over his face and wears ponchos to better hide his body. His hair, while still mostly golden, has prominent grey streaks. His face possesses mild wrinkles. His smile is extraordinarily sincere though he does not smile often.

Personality: Deceptive and manipulative this southern guy figured out how to best use his charms to convince people to do what he wants. He is a thrill seeker, he laughs at people and throws down challenges. He is highly competitive and combative.

History: Sold as a small child to a slaver, Jocelyn was an assistant, and all too frequently test subject. He eventually earned his freedom when his former master disappeared. From there he went from mercenary job to mercenary job. During his travels, Jocelyn and his party rested in a cavern that was (unknown to them) infused with powerful dark magic. Upon awakening, Jocelyn discovered the rest of his party dead, transformed into horrible, mindless undead versions of their former selves. Jocelyn fled the cavern, stopping for breath at a small pool, and only then realizing his own horrible transformation.

Motivation: A need for knowledge about a nearby landmark; and to be a spy again

Flaws: Disease. Bonds: Attractive, Adventurer, Mentor, Job. Occupation: Servant

Voice: Hollow voice
